However, despite the challenges, there are still a lot of opportunities for adult students out there, but it does take some time and effort to find them. Although you may already have a job, it will still be difficult to pay for college because college in general is expensive. And for the working adults who get a smaller tuition reimbursementwell, theyre in luck. The federal limit for giving employees tuition reimbursement without being taxed is 5,250 per year. Rather than college loans, you might consider taking an alternate approach to paying for school. Fortunately, college grants can help you cover tuition costs without incurring debt. Although most scholarship grants are aimed at high school adolescents, there are a few available for adults returning to school. a great way to find free money for college is to look where you live. I recommend students start in their own community, school or family to really get to know themselves, their family history, memberships, involvement and employment so that they have the facts about possible scholarship connections, said kim stezala, known as the scholarship lady.
